What Is Nonapeptide-34?
Nonapeptide-34 is a synthetic peptide that has garnered attention in the cosmetic industry for its skin conditioning properties. This peptide is composed of the amino acids: aspartic acid, cysteine, phenylalanine, histidine, isoleucine, tryptophan, and tyrosine.
The journey of Nonapeptide-34 into the world of cosmetics is relatively recent, stemming from advancements in peptide synthesis and a growing interest in bioactive compounds that can deliver targeted skin benefits. Initially, peptides like Nonapeptide-34 were studied for their roles in cellular communication and tissue repair. As research progressed, their potential for enhancing skin health and appearance became evident, leading to their incorporation into skincare formulations.
Nonapeptide-34 is produced through a process known as solid-phase peptide synthesis (SPPS). This method involves sequentially adding amino acids to a growing peptide chain anchored to a solid resin. Each amino acid is protected by specific chemical groups to prevent unwanted reactions. Once the peptide chain is fully assembled, it is cleaved from the resin and purified to obtain the final product. This meticulous process ensures the high purity and efficacy of Nonapeptide-34, making it a valuable ingredient in modern skincare products.
The Benefits/Uses of Nonapeptide-34
In this section, we will delve into the officially recognized cosmetic benefits and uses of Nonapeptide-34:
Skin Conditioning
Nonapeptide-34 is primarily known for its skin conditioning properties. This means it helps to maintain the skin in good condition by improving its overall appearance and texture. When used in cosmetic formulations, Nonapeptide-34 can help to make the skin feel smoother, softer, and more hydrated. It works by interacting with the skin’s natural processes to enhance its barrier function, which can lead to a healthier and more resilient complexion.
Note: the listed benefits above are exclusively based on the officially recognized and defined functions of the ingredient, as documented by the International Nomenclature of Cosmetic Ingredients (INCI).
Potential Side Effects & Other Considerations
Nonapeptide-34 is generally considered safe for topical application in cosmetic products. However, as with any skincare ingredient, there are potential side effects and considerations to keep in mind:
- Skin irritation
- Redness
- Itching
- Allergic reactions
Regarding individuals who are pregnant or breastfeeding, data and research on the topical usage of Nonapeptide-34 during pregnancy and breastfeeding are lacking. Therefore, it is advisable for these individuals to consult a healthcare professional for further advice before using products containing this ingredient.
Adverse reactions to Nonapeptide-34 are relatively uncommon, but it is always prudent to conduct a patch test before widespread usage to ensure there are no adverse reactions.
Nonapeptide-34 has a comedogenic rating of 0, meaning it is considered non-comedogenic. This is beneficial for individuals prone to acne, blemishes, or breakouts, as it is unlikely to clog pores or exacerbate these conditions.
